Legato Capital Management LLC lifted its stake in Astera Labs, Inc. (NASDAQ:ALAB – Free Report) by 68.2%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 25,612 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 10,386 shares during the quarter. Legato Capital Management LLC’s holdings in Astera Labs were worth $3,392,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Astera Labs Profile
Astera Labs, Inc designs, manufactures, and sells semiconductor-based connectivity solutions for cloud and AI infrastructure. Its Intelligent Connectivity Platform is comprised of a portfolio of data, network, and memory connectivity products, which are built on a unifying software-defined architecture that enables customers to deploy and operate high performance cloud and AI infrastructure at scale.
